The ingredients needed to make My Family's Napa Cabbage and Pork Stewed Udon Noodles:
  1. You need 6 leaves Napa cabbage (Chinese cabbage)
  2. Provide 1 Japanese leek
  3. You need 150 grams Pork (rib, thinly sliced, etc.)
  4. Get 1 Chikuwa
  5. Get 1 Aburaage
  6. Provide 2 bunches Udon (boiled)
  7. Take 3 Mochi (rice cakes)
  8. Provide 500 ml ■Water
  9. Prepare 40 ml ■Sake
  10. Prepare 1 tsp ■Dashi stock granules
  11. Prepare 1 tbsp ■Soy sauce
  12. Prepare 1/2 tsp ■Salt
Steps to make My Family's Napa Cabbage and Pork Stewed Udon Noodles:
  1. Cut all of the ingredients except the udon and mochi into bite-sized pieces.
  2. Add water, sake, soy sauce, and dashi stock granules into a pot or clay pot, and bring to a boil.
  3. Add napa cabbage and pork alternatively in layers, ending with the napa cabbage on top. Add the rest of the ingredients.
  4. When the ingredients have cooked through, it's done.
